You’ll want to do your very best on the examination, so we’ll give you some information about what you can expect on your testing day. You can take the subtests separately, or you can take them all on the same day.
You can only take the CSET Agriculture test on a computer program at an official test center. The CSET Agriculture practice test consists of three subtests. Each subtest includes 40 multiple choice questions and 3 constructed-response questions.
CSET Agriculture test #172 practice test (subtest I) has 25 multiple choice questions on plant and soil science and 15 questions on ornamental horticulture, plus the constructed response questions.
CSET Agriculture test #173 practice test (subtest II) has 25 questions on animal science and 15 questions on environmental science and natural resource management, along with 3 constructed-response questions.
CSET Agriculture test #174 practice test (subtest III) consists of 20 multiple choice questions on agricultural business and economics and 20 multiple choice questions on agricultural systems technology, along with 3 constructed-response questions.
The test may also include questions that will be evaluated for a future test administration. These questions won’t affect your score at all. You will be allowed 1 hour and 45 minutes for each subtest or 5 hours and 15 minutes if you choose to take all three subtests in one session.
You will have plenty of time. You will also have an additional 15 minutes of time to complete a nondisclosure agreement and view a tutorial. Be aware that the time does not stop if you need to take a break. Use these practice tests to help you get a passing score. You will need to get a score of 220 in order to pass the test. Your test results will be released within 7 weeks of your test date.
